Greetings citizens of Bob. I come to you tonight with an announcement from Rage Co.
After much debate, we have decided to open our recruiting doors to 5 lucky participants. Said participants shall receive the full benefit of our years of knowledge and our drive to help everyone become the successful war machine that they aspire to be. This open application process is available to anyone regardless of NS.
The current breakdown of the contract is as follows:
Any applicant nation under the 30k NS limit will receive an infusion of 15 million in cash. If your trades are not in order you will be assigned to a trade circle appropriate to your starting resources. Cash infusions shall continue until your NS has reached 30k. At this point you will have successfully completed several, if not all, of our strengthening programs (who's names must remain proprietary) and you will be asked to turn around and begin giving back to the younger nations of [r]age that which has been given to you.
Any applicant over the 30k NS limit will receive an infusion of 250 tech. If we deem that you require enrollment in our strengthening programs, you will begin receiving cash infusions in order to achieve these goals. If your trades are not in order, we will assign you a trade circle based on your starting resources. Once all strengthening programs have been completed you will be asked to turn around and begin giving back to the younger nations of [r]age that which has been given to you.
By signing onto [r]age, you agree to serve a term of no less than 90 days. This is a sad but necessary step that we feel is appropriate to weed out the dregs and those who might abuse our generosity. Keep in mind, these are NOT recruitment bonuses. A bonus is a one time payment, a bribe if you will, in exchange for loyalty. This is a path to success for 5 lucky people. Welcome home.
If you have always had dreams and goals of becoming a power on Bob, join us. We will craft you into that which you desire most.
